General Business Rules for Paymentof State Home Per Diem • VA per diem payments to States are only paid for the care of eligible Veterans. • VA pays per diem to State Homes for the care of Veterans irrespective of whether the Veteran has wartime or peacetime service. • The Secretary of the Department of Veterans Affairs may adjust the per diem rates each year. • Non-Veteran residents are not entitled to payment of VA aid.

Alignment of VHA State Home Program Management Responsibilities Responsibilities for managing the state home program are shared by VHA’s Chief Business Office and VHA’s Office of Geriatrics and Extended Care The State Home Per Diem Program is a benefit administration and payment processing program which is managed by the VHA Chief Business Office (CBO).

  6. Roles and Responsibilities The Chief Business Office (CBO), through it’s National Fee Program Office, is responsible for management of the state home per diem program, to include: • (1) Health Care Benefit Administration, including regulatory and national policy development • (2) Management and oversight of eligibility, authorizations and per diem payment program • (3) Provision of operational oversight and training, related to (1) and (2) above for VHA and Non-VA Stakeholders.

  7. Roles and Responsibilities • CBO program responsibilities (continued) • (4) Promoting collaborative relationships with VA and Non-VA stakeholders and maintaining communication and networking with program leaders through interactive forums such as meetings, mail groups and national conference calls. • (5) Managing state home budgeting processes, the provision of fiscal year per diem funds to the VA Medical Centers of Jurisdiction based on projected needs, and the provision of supplemental per diem funds, when required. • (6) Compiling products/reports that depict state home workload and expenditure trends.

  8. Roles and Responsibilities VA Medical Center of Jurisdiction Per Diem Point of Contact (POC). The VA Medical Center Per Diem POC has the capacity, skills and experience required to provide guidance to the VAMC and state Veterans home staff and to effectively communicate program responsibilities and outcomes with state officials, VA Medical Center and VISN managers and CBO and GEC staff. They also are responsible for: • (1) promoting collaborative relationships with VA and Non-VA stakeholders and maintaining communication and networking with program leaders through the participation in interactive forums such as meetings, mail groups and national conference calls. • (2) ensuring the timely processing and reconciliation of all documentation, including daily admissions, discharges, and the accuracy of payment processing actions.

  9. Roles and Responsibilities VA Medical Center of Jurisdiction Per Diem Point of Contact (POC) -- continued. • (3) formulating and executing budget and audit oversight requirements. • (4) monitoring and evaluating the station-level state home program to assess program quality and assure compliance with VHA per diem requirements.. • (5) reporting potential problems, in a timely manner, to program leadership.

Summary • VA’s state home program plays a major role in delivering long term care to our nation’s veterans. • The program is expected to grow by approximately 25% over the next three fiscal years. • Major expenditures are made in support of this program. It is important that the funds entrusted to the program are appropriately managed. • State home program managers at CBO, GEC, VISNs and VA Medical Centers of Jurisdiction play important roles in assuring that program goals are met.
